## Deploying the Gatewick Proctor Queue

Deploys are pretty painless: push to main, wait for the pipeline, then watch the queue drain dashboard for five minutes. If candidates pile up mid-exam, roll back first and ask questions later — the queue replays safely. Everything the workers care about lives in one config block, shown here for reference.

settings of bafof-yagef:
JOROX_PIN=8740
JOROX_TENANT=pelox
JOROX_METRICS_HOST=metrics.jorox.qorvelworks.internal
JOROX_SEAL=seal_c78f63c1
JOROX_STANDBY_TEAM=norax

Onboarding: Incremental rebuilds on Larkspur. The static site rebuilds only pages whose content hash changed; the manifest lives in the build cache bucket. Never wipe the cache manually — use `larkspur rebuild --scoped`. Full rebuilds take ~40 minutes; incremental under 2. If the manifest corrupts, restore it from the nightly snapshot via the Quillgate console. Console access requires unlocking the maintainer keyring with the recovery passphrase below.

vault phrase of bagaf-kajeg = jorath-feniel-briir-siliel-ralix

During last week's audit we found that the staging and production matchers are running different similarity thresholds, which explains why staging flagged 340 duplicate clusters that production silently merged. The drift appears to have been introduced during the Q3 hotfix, when a manual edit on the production host was never committed back to the template. Until we restore parity, merge metrics between environments are not comparable. Production is currently running with the values below.

deployment values, yadug-bawif:
[framir]
team = pelox
access_code = ac_a38ab2
owner = tamion.julael
host = framir.tolvaqlabs.test
port = 11211
peer = tammir.zemvargrid.local
salt = 2215ef03
pin = 1541